General RV Ashland VA damaged our coach

For those that might be interested:

Bought an Entegra Accolade 37TS from General RV in Ashland, VA. The process became a nightmare when we requested Solar, Winegard Connect 2, Maxx Air vent cover, and Mobile Eye as add-ons.

Come PDI day we showed up and the coach was not ready. We walked away without signing the papers after doing the PDI. General RV was willing to work through some issues and a follow-up PDI was scheduled.

During the initial PDI one of the items found was the prop for the bed was not connected to the base of the bed so it would not hold the bed in the raised (open position). A couple of days after we walked away we were told all PDI items were corrected.

When we "re-walked" the coach we found this damage that was not present during the initial PDI.

General RV said they would order the parts and let us know when they come in. After getting the coach home I went to extend and retract the bedroom slide and it sounded that something was being torn apart. When I investigated I found this:

General RV had mounted the bed prop bracket in such a manner that it was lower that the bed platform and every time the slide was extended or retracted it would act like a hook or extremely dull saw blade and start tearing things apart. It is even beginning to remove the wood panel holding the breaker panel.

The dealership has not responded regarding this issue. General RV Customer Care says they understand our concern about reliable service and we can use any dealer we want but we need to confirm they accept our warranty.

Had a lengthy (30 min) conversation with Jayco yesterday about a couple of items on the Accolade and options for service in my area. I informed Jayco that I would give General RV one opportunity to service this coach and if they screw that up I will be going elsewhere. Right now the list for repair is:
  • The bed trim that General RV damaged and remounting the bed prop bracket
  • Mudflap in front of passenger's side duals not secure on the top causing the mudflap to rub the tire causing damage to the mudflap and possibly shaving the inner dual tire.
  • Electric reel for power cord not working. It has power but does not retract the cord.

I have a "while you wait" appointment for next Friday for the dealer to verify the repairs needed and identify any parts requirements. I will then return to the dealer when the parts arrive for repairs. This dealer's policy is coaches do not sit on their lot while waiting parts.

The discussion with Jayco yesterday resulted in the decision that this dealer gets one shot to get it right. If they don't Jayco will begin working with an independent service center of my choice for warranty repairs.

Also today I received an email from a Jayco Master Scheduler who is going to work with me on scheduling the coach to have the living area slide removed and shimmed and have the bow in the side wall removed and then have the side of the coach repainted as necessary. Jayco estimates a two week period for those repairs and they asked me to assemble a list of other items I would like done while it is at factory service.

So far, pretty decent customer support and they have started sending the technical drawings and diagrams as they are requested. According to them there are too many to do a batch emailing.
